Augmented reality, or AR for short, is one of the most talked-about technology trends in construction. Using the advanced camera and sensor technology, AR combines one’s physical surroundings with computer-generated information and presents it in real-time. While the technology has been used in video games for years, this “augmented” experience is recently making waves in construction, offering immense opportunities to improve the project lifecycle. By combining digital and physical views, augmented reality is helping construction teams drive more efficiency, accuracy, and overall confidence in their projects. The AR global market is expected to grow $90 billion by 2020. Rather than replacing workers on the field, AR can be used to greatly enhance the ways humans and digital machines work together. As technology continues to mature and become adopted, augmented reality in construction will become an invaluable tool and has the potential to change the future of the building.
What it does
Visualize AR projects the pre-built 3D model on the physical construction plan, provides different angles and methods to look and visualize at it.
How I built it
It is built on unity3d, using the echoar cloud. The Image target is a random one chosen from google.
